Default 1960 Nu-Card Highlights VS 1961 Nu-Card Scoops

1960 Nu-Card Highlights (72 cards) TOUGH
1961 Nu-Card Scoops (80 cards) EASY

I've completed the 1961 set and continue to work on the 1960 postcard sized cards I have 60 of the 72 cards and looking for more!

I never really compared the sets. Card #17-#72 both depict the same news item exceptions #28 #53 #55 #67 some use the same photo some use a different photo.

From KEYMAN COLLECTIBLES dot com:

"The 1961 Nu-card Baseball scoops set consist of 80 cards numbered 401-480. The numbers are a continuation of past Nu-Card sets."

I know the 1961 Nu Card football cards are numbered 101-180 can't confirm numbering due to past sets?
